FAQs for finding home health aides near you in Hillsboro, OR
What does a home health aide do near me in Hillsboro, OR?
If you’re planning to hire a home health aide near you in Hillsboro, OR, it’s important to understand that there is no one standard role that a home health aide takes on. A home health aide isn’t a nurse, but can help with health related tasks like ensuring their clients take their medicine on time, transporting them to doctors appointments, picking up prescriptions, and making sure they are well fed and bathed.

How much does it cost to hire a home health aide near me in Hillsboro, OR?
The average rate for hiring home health aides near you in Hillsboro, OR on Care.com as of May, 2024 is $30.00 per hour. It’s worth noting that the rate each individual home health aide charges depends on the level of care required, the provider's certifications, and their years of experience.
